Deaminase-assisted single-molecule and single-cell chromatin fiber sequencing
Gene regulation is mediated by the co-occupancy of numerous proteins along individual chromatin fibers. However, our tools for deeply profiling how proteins co-occupy individual fibers, especially at ...

Here ends our foray into rDNA variation in model organisms—w/ Christine Queitsch, Bonnie Brewer, and many others. Especially Ashley Hall and Elizabeth Morton.

tl;dr: In natural ranges of rDNA copy number, phenotypes are rare (yeast + C. elegans).
But outside those ranges? Some things happen.
